Output 63e9310d86b1c2110a289c1b1b1b3c4057f6cc9b343c7e4f78240d0e94c2396e:0

value
46209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bb0489b3e8c351bec7603c29d194a9e508574c5 OP_EQUAL
address
3A3pbQCqhbDLpNB6aHk2xVUYZo4PFK5hzh
transaction
63e9310d86b1c2110a289c1b1b1b3c4057f6cc9b343c7e4f78240d0e94c2396e
confirmations
210623
spent
true